โ Here's why you should stop asking them
We ran a survey.
The verdict?
76% of candidates aren't fans or outright hate brainteaser questions.
Think:
โ How many ping pong balls fit in a 747?
โ How many gas stations are in the US?
The problem?
โ They don't predict performance
โ They create stress, not insight
โ They reflect more on the interviewer than the candidate
Research backs this up:
- Google's internal data (via Work Rules, Laszlo Bock) found no value in brainteasersโand banned them.
- The Journal of Applied Psychology study found that interviewers who favor brainteasers score higher in narcissism and sadism.
